Annual Easter Sunrise Service
Sunday, April 9, 7am
Northport Village Park
A yearly tradition sponsored by the Ecumenical Lay Council of Northport-East Northport, a nonprofit consortium of local houses of worship dedicated to reaching out to the community’s needy.

Annual Easter Egg Hunt
Sunday, April 9, 1pm
Northport Village Park
The Village of Northport will hold its annual Easter egg hunt with kid races on April 9 at Northport Village Park. Egg hunting begins at 1pm; sponsored by the Northport-Centerport Lions Club.

Chunky Knit Blanket Workshop
Thursday, April 13, 6-9pm
Nest on Main, 135 Main Street, Northport Village
Nest on Main’s most popular workshop is back! Join instructor Keri Puglisi (Loops by Keri) and make a one-of-a-kind chunky knit blanket that looks and feels great. No knitting experience is needed to take this class. No needles either, just your hands! All materials are included in the price of this class. For more information, and to register, click here.

Opioid Overdose Prevention Training
Tuesday, April 25, 7pm
East Northport Public Library
Training for adults 16 years of age and older on how to recognize the signs of an opioid overdose and administer Narcan. Registration is underway here. This program is co-sponsored by CN Guidance and Counseling Services.

Medicine Collections
Thursday, April 27, 3:30-6:30pm
Northport and East Northport Public Libraries
The Northport Police Department and the Suffolk County Sheriff’s Office will be collecting unused or expired prescription and over-the-counter medications; no questions asked and no personal information required. Only medications in pill form will be accepted and must be placed in plastic bags before arrival.
